1
Press the MENU button and use the
J-dial to select "3. GENERAL SET",
and then turn the S-dial clockwise.
The <GENERAL SET> screen appears.
2
Turn the J-dial, select the desired
submenu, and turn the S-dial
clockwise.
The selected screen (A~G) is
displayed. Refer to the appropriate
pages for the settings.
